WebNov 4, 2024 · Here are the three main questions to ask to understand if your roof insurance is good or not. The first question refers to the perils that are covered, the second refers to how you will be paid and the third refers to how much money you get in a claim : Is it All Risk or Open Perils Coverage for your home and the roof, or is it Named Perils? WebJan 9, 2024 · Comparative analysis of exposed surfaces should be made to determine the relative size, hardness, frequency, and damage-causing potential of hail that fell at a site before roofing damage determinations are made. Careful, thorough inspection and documentation procedures should be followed to support any opinions rendered. WebThe visual signs of hail damage vary depending on the materials of the roof.
